Explain why world war on broke out in 1914

World war 1 broke out in 1914 because a group of Serbian nationalists (The Black Hand) assassinated the duke of Austria-Hungary. Austria -Hungary threatened Serbia with a bunch of wishes that they wanted Serbia to due for them. Due to the treaty between Serbia and Russia, Serbia said no. Germany, who had a treaty with Austria-Hungary threatened to attack if Russia mobilized its army. Russia did and Germany invaded Belgium. This brought Great Britain and France into the war.
